FEDERAL COST DATA

Four ways to read college price.

Annual college-wide figures from the current College Scorecard release. Average net price covers full-time, first-time undergraduates receiving federal aid; public-college figures use in-state students. Program tuition and individual aid offers may differ.

Published in-state tuition$3,568
Sticker price
Published out-of-state tuition$7,816
Sticker price
Average net price$660
Title IV student average
Cost of attendance$11,784
Tuition + living budget
PRICE SOURCECollege reported · annual amount · federal dataset

ALL REPORTABLE PROGRAM CATEGORIES

Explore exact field-and-credential outcomes

Federal fieldCredentialEarnings, year 4Federal debt2023–24 awards
Registered Nursing, Nursing Administration, Nursing Research and Clinical NursingAssociate's Degree$80,749$26,613Not reported
Engineering, GeneralAssociate's Degree$76,979$11,813Not reported
Computer ProgrammingAssociate's Degree$68,046$15,138Not reported
Allied Health Diagnostic, Intervention, and Treatment ProfessionsAssociate's Degree$64,436$20,828Not reported
Liberal Arts and Sciences, General Studies and HumanitiesUndergraduate Certificate or Diploma$64,309$24,7501,650
Computer Systems Networking and TelecommunicationsAssociate's Degree$61,938Not availableNot reported
Computer Systems Networking and TelecommunicationsUndergraduate Certificate or Diploma$55,868$12,4646
Criminal Justice and CorrectionsAssociate's Degree$52,172$15,200Not reported
Business/Commerce, GeneralAssociate's Degree$49,609$32,406Not reported
Business Administration, Management and OperationsAssociate's Degree$47,684$14,250Not reported
Allied Health and Medical Assisting ServicesAssociate's Degree$47,247$19,750Not reported
Liberal Arts and Sciences, General Studies and HumanitiesAssociate's Degree$40,696$16,767Not reported
Teacher Education and Professional Development, Specific Levels and MethodsAssociate's Degree$38,566$17,365Not reported
Culinary Arts and Related ServicesUndergraduate Certificate or Diploma$31,371$19,14423
Design and Applied ArtsAssociate's Degree$27,504$19,075Not reported
Practical Nursing, Vocational Nursing and Nursing AssistantsUndergraduate Certificate or DiplomaNot available$17,570Not reported

Awards use first-major IPEDS completions aggregated to the same four-digit field and credential.
